Education Department Overview

Clarendon College's Education Department is designed for students who plan to pursue a degree in Education, through enriched integrated pre-service courses and content experience that:

1)    provide active recruitment and support of undergraduates interested in a teaching career, especially in high need fields such as secondary math and science education. Bilingual education, and special education;

2)    provide students with opportunities to participate in early field experiences including middle and high school classrooms with varied and diverse student populations;

3)    provide students with support from college and school faculty, preferably in small cohort groups, for the purpose of introducing and analyzing the culture of schooling and classrooms from the perspectives of language, gender, socioeconomic, ethnic, and disability-based academic diversity and equity.
